你查询的IP:[159.226.190.239]  地理位置:中国–北京–北京科技网

最新查询123.144.185.8 116.95.12.172 119.254.1.6 218.79.60.181 210.21.197.55 124.112.251.1 203.94.192.125 119.206.167.89 123.196.50.225 159.226.190.239 202.189.80.72 121.255.152.245 122.204.72.143 202.125.176.131 123.178.124.128 119.20.140.127 222.192.75.153 119.3.36.218 203.100.80.143 122.119.116.42 123.136.80.244 116.1.37.79 123.8.14.122 125.169.158.168 202.92.252.144 119.58.40.27 203.100.96.145 123.176.80.176 123.99.128.70 220.252.44.98 125.216.29.228